Output 2d6c76f32c76fa4a8705218868eac7326f86dd53e57c410f74abc2cedfc04930:20

value
1029609124
script pubkey
OP_0 OP_PUSHBYTES_20 824de3ef7cbf71efe76a231c748e7fb3010163f2
address
bc1qsfx78mmuhac7lem2yvw8frnlkvqszcljaw3s78
transaction
2d6c76f32c76fa4a8705218868eac7326f86dd53e57c410f74abc2cedfc04930